What is a Casino Crypto Coin?
A casino crypto coin is a cryptocurrency specifically developed or embraced for usage within online gaming platforms. These aren't always distinct to one casino; lots of platforms use established assets like Bitcoin (BTC), Ethereum (ETH), or Tether (GBPT). Nevertheless, some platforms have developed their own "native tokens," which operate within their particular community to use benefits, governance rights, or marked down transaction fees.

2. Provably Fair Gaming
Blockchain innovation presents "Provably Fair" algorithms. By using cryptographic hashes, gamers can verify that the result of a slot spin or a card shuffle was identified truthfully and was not manipulated by the platform. This brings a level of trust that was previously impossible in the "black box" of traditional online casinos.

Types of Crypto Assets Used in Casinos
Not all crypto coins serve the very same purpose in a casino environment. They generally fall into one of 3 categories:
- Market-Leading Assets (BTC, ETH, LTC): These are the workhorses of the industry. They are utilized mainly for their stability and wide liquidity.
- Stablecoins (GBPT, GBPC): These are pegged to fiat currencies (typically the United States Dollar). They are preferred by gamers who want the speed of crypto without the unpredictable rate swings of Bitcoin.
- Native Utility Tokens: Coins established by specific gambling establishments. Holding these tokens might approve the user a share of the casino's earnings, decreased betting fees, or access to unique high-roller events.
Dangers to Consider
While the advantages are significant, the crypto-gambling area is not without threat. Educated players should know the following:
- Price Volatility: If a gamer wins in a coin that drops in worth by 20% before they withdraw, their effective payouts are diminished.
- Absence of Regulation: Because numerous crypto gambling establishments run throughout jurisdictions, players do not constantly have the very same customer security rights as they would with a state-licensed fiat casino.
- Irreversibility: Blockchain deals can not be reversed. If a user sends out funds to the incorrect wallet address, those funds are completely lost.
- Security Responsibility: Unlike a savings account, there is no "forgot password" button for a personal key. If a user loses access to their digital wallet, they efficiently lose their funds.
